very good value for the price paid
I liked that its water proof and very powerful.
It came with a fusion blade which I consider useless as the trimmer would be only a holder stick for the blade, if you have the original fusion handle then just use it for a skin level shaving.
Overall, I'm impressed with the results of this all-purpose trimmer. It is reasonably priced, quality made, and gets the job done.

What a nifty, little product.
I purchase this trimmer for about $12 after spending $130 on a trimmer that turned out to be horrible. I didn't expect much for $12, but was blown away with how good it is.
It's well made, cleverly designed, has plenty of power, the battery lasts for ages, it works really well on ANY part of your body and it looks pretty good too.
The only thing that would make it better was if it was a bit wider.
